High Density Emi Filter Design In High Power Three-Phase Motor Drive Systems, Jing Xue Aug 2014

High Density Emi Filter Design In High Power Three-Phase Motor Drive Systems, Jing Xue

Doctoral Dissertations

High density EMI filter is important in the application of more-electric-aircraft (MEA). In this work, the author is focusing on several major aspects of EMI filter design that would influence the power density.

In Chapter 1, the feature of EMI study and conventional design methods are reviewed.

The interaction between the common-mode (CM) and differential-mode (DM) noise is one key factor introducing unnecessary weight to EMI filter design. Design And Control Of High Power Density Motor Drive, Dong Jiang Dec 2011

Design And Control Of High Power Density Motor Drive, Dong Jiang

Doctoral Dissertations

This dissertation aims at developing techniques to achieve high power density in motor drives under the performance requirements for transportation system. Four main factors influencing the power density are the main objects of the dissertation: devices, passive components, pulse width modulation (PWM) methods and motor control methods.

Firstly, the application of SiC devices could improve the power density of the motor drive.
